PORTLAND — E2Tech is bringing legislators, lobbyists and political experts together to discuss recent legislation and look ahead at initiatives that will define the political and policy landscape for the next governor and Legislature.

The forum, “Energy & Environmental Policy in an Election Year,” will take place on Thursday, May 22, from 7:15 a.m. to 9:30 a.m., at Talbot Lecture Hall, Luther Bonney Hall, USM campus, 85 Bedford St., Portland.
